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Carissa vs Dried Acorns:
- 100 grams of Carissa have more Vitamin C than Dried Acorns.
- While 100 g of Dried Acorns contain 3.7 times more Vitamin B1, 2.6 times more Vitamin B2 and 12 times more Vitamin B3 than Raw Carissa.
- 100 grams of Carissa have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B3
- 100 grams of Dried Acorns have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
- Both Raw Carissa as well as Dried Acorns have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A and Vitamin B12 in 100 grams.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Carissa vs Dried Acorns:
- 100 grams of Carissa have 1.3 times more Iron and 16.6 times more Water than Dried Acorns.
- While 100 g of Dried Acorns contain 4.9 times more Calcium, 3.9 times more Copper, 5.1 times more Magnesium, 14.7 times more Phosphorus and 2.7 times more Potassium than Raw Carissa.
- 100 grams of Carissa lack sufficient amounts of Calcium and Phosphorus
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
- 100 g of Dried Acorns contain 8.2 times more Energy, 24.2 times more Fat, 3.9 times more Carbohydrate and 16.2 times more Protein than Raw Carissa.
- 100 grams of Carissa provide inadequate amounts of Protein
